Transaction 581b9007fcf2443d6ef90a34ab074899884535de9c502d5a0998f46cee7c3bd3

1 Input
2 Outputs
  • 581b9007fcf2443d6ef90a34ab074899884535de9c502d5a0998f46cee7c3bd3:0
  • value  391814178
    address  3MjQ91po5AGBRdttnmu3WXGVAzugpz2WhT
  • 581b9007fcf2443d6ef90a34ab074899884535de9c502d5a0998f46cee7c3bd3:1
  • value  139207
    address  16zuxNxyH793RzNZpSdfrnuRs7KHVmxK6Q